The departmental honors program is open to all qualified students with a 3.7 GPA. in Political Science and a 3.5 overall GPA. This program is geared to advanced students who wish to pursue their study in political science in a more intensive manner.
The core of this program is the writing of a major research paper, an honors thesis, which is completed in the senior year of study. The honors thesis provides an opportunity for students to do in-depth research on a topic of their choice. For students planning to attend either graduate school or law school, this program is highly recommended. Such schools tend to look favorably upon students who have completed a major, independent research project as undergraduates.
Writing an honors thesis also allows for the development of a stronger academic relationship between the student and the student's faculty thesis advisor, and this in turn allows faculty to write more effective letters of recommendation.
